What Services Do Gutter Installation Companies Offer?

By selecting a full-service gutter installation company, you'll get the longest lifespan and best value from your system. The Burbank companies we recommend can do all these jobs and more:

  • Gutter guard installation: By hiring a professional to install gutter guards, you can boost your system's efficiency and increase its lifespan by preventing clogs from leaves and seeds. Guards also help stop pests from making their home in your gutters.
  • Cleaning: Regular gutter cleaning is crucial for success, but it isn't as simple as it looks. A professional can handle the dirty work for you to help prevent warping, clogging, and overflowing.
  • Installation: Licensed gutter companies have the knowledge and resources to cut and install new gutters without damaging your roof.
  • Repair: Whether you're dealing with mold, holes, sagging, cracking, or loose sections, an experienced Burbank gutter professional can identify and resolve your gutter issues quickly.
You can use a gutter company's services as you need. Many providers will offer long-term plans that cover installation, repairs, and routine cleaning, which are billed monthly or annually.

How To Choose a Gutter Installer

Research potential gutter installers in great depth first, so you don't overpay or get bad service. When assessing gutter installation companies, look for:

Assess Their Experience

When searching for a gutter installation company, try to select a local company that's been operating for many years or decades. This experience signals that the company understands your area's weather and climate, as well as common local home designs, which helps them choose the right gutters for your home. Additionally, these companies have proven practices for safe, efficient gutter installation.

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ance

Make sure to pick a provider with the proper qualifications. Ask to see licensing, bonding, and insurance documentation before committing to a contract. Current credentials mean that a company follows best practices and local regulations, giving you peace of mind.

Check Reviews and Referrals

Spend time looking through online reviews on sites such as Yelp, Google, and the Better Business Bureau to confirm that the company has a proven track record of providing good customer service and great project results. Look for long-term satisfied customers to get a sense of the company's overall reliability. Watch for any red flags, such as unresolved complaints or unfinished jobs. All the providers we recommend boast a good average rating across a high number of reviews.

Choose Reputable Brands

Choose a business that's certified through the gutter manufacturer. You'll want an installer that is formally trained to complete all gutter installations per the manufacturer's specifications in order to get the best results.

Examine Warranties

Only hire a provider that offers strong manufacturer warranties on materials as well as their own installation guarantees. Look for warranties that last 5 to 10 years for standard aluminum gutters and 1–3 years for labor.

Gutter Installation Materials

Look for durable materials – such as heavy-gauge aluminum – that won't easily warp, decay, or rust over time. Materials that can handle Burbank’s local weather are best. Also check that paints and finishes have an equally long lifespan.

Questions to Ask

To properly evaluate potential gutter companies, you'll need to take the time to ask detailed questions such as these:

  • How long is the installation process? Most companies are typically able to finish a gutter installation project in around one day's time.
  • What are the specific warranty details for materials and labor? Quality materials are typically backed by 5–10 year warranties. Labor is typically back by a 1-3 year guarantee.
  • What gutter materials are best for my specific home style and the local weather conditions? Consider the benefits and drawbacks of each gutter material, taking into account key factors such as Burbank's typical rainfall, snowfall, and the weight and volume of the gutters.
  • Will you give me a detailed quote for both full gutter replacement and fixes for problem areas? Get quotes in writing from companies, so you understand exactly what the price of gutter installation will be before the project starts.
  • What steps do you take to ensure my new gutters have the right pitch and slope to prevent standing water? Correct pitch and slope help reduce overflow risk. Your gutter installation specialist should know how to properly align your gutter system with your roof.
  • Can you also install gutter guards? Installing gutter guards helps prevent clogs that result from leaves, twigs, and other debris getting into your gutters.
  • How do you ensure a smooth integration with my existing roof? Check whether steps like underlayment replacement are included.
Taking the time to thoroughly evaluate all your options helps you select the best gutter installer for your home. Investing in new gutters today protects against costly water and structural damage in the future.

Frequently Asked Questions About Gutters in Burbank, IL

Browsing online reviews is one way to verify the reputation of a gutter services company. When it's time to speak with a representative, confirm that the company is properly insured, and ask them to explain how the work will or will not affect your roof warranty. Lastly, a reliable Burbank gutter services company should provide in writing both a cost estimate and an explanation of its warranty policy.

The average amount you can expect to pay for gutter installation in Burbank is between $402-$3,506, or about $3.89 per linear foot. The size of your home and the number of levels it has will affect the cost, as will the material you choose and if you want sectional or seamless gutters. The only surefire way to estimate how much you'll pay for gutter installation in Burbank is to talk to one or more gutter installation companies to ask for a free estimate. When you do contact a company, you should already have a general idea of the gutter material you want, and how long the system will need to be.

For all gutter services, the benefits of working with a local Burbank gutter company include improved safety, professional quality of work, and decreased risk of future problems. For installation, hiring a professional usually means getting a warranty for both services and materials. When it’s time for your gutters to be replaced, a gutter services professional can supply materials and later discard both leftover materials and waste, which will help you save time and keep your yard clean.

Frequently, Burbank's gutter companies and "all-purpose" home service companies will also offer other services, such as repair or cleaning for your roofing, windows, or siding. If you need multiple services, contact one or more companies from our above list to find out what kind of service packages they offer.

The top concern when doing DIY gutter maintenance? Safety. Always be sure you work on a ladder, not from the roof, where you're more likely to fall. Take care to make sure that your ladder is stable, and wear work gloves. Start by making sure the downspout is clear, so standing water can flow out of the system, and finish by using a hose or bucket of water to flush the gutters to confirm that they're draining properly.

Whenever you're doing any kind of work on your gutters, check the brackets attaching your gutter system to your house to determine if they need to be tightened, repaired, or replaced. You can also see if there are any holes, and seal them when the gutters are dry.

If your area gets the occasional heavy rainstorm, or if you want to consolidate runoff from multiple gutters, you might consider adding one or more conductor heads onto your gutter system. These wider components provide your gutters with more time to drain without overflowing. Depending on your roof’s overhang, you might think about using a drain chain to help your gutter system drain. Rain chains allow water to drain directly to the ground, similar to a downspout, and can be good for houses with deeper overhangs. Accessories such as fascia brackets, decorative boots, and downspout brackets can improve the appearance of your gutters.
